High-leverage forex brokers offer the opportunity to control larger positions with a smaller amount of capital. For example, with leverage of 1:100, a trader can control a $10,000 position with just $100. Forex brokers in Ireland follow the European Securities and Markets Authority (ESMA) guidelines. Under these guidelines, brokers are allowed to offer leverage of 1:30 for major currency pairs and 1:20 for minors and exotics to protect retail investors from excessive risk. However, some brokers offer professional accounts that provide leverage as high as 1:500. Additionally, some regulated brokers have offshore entities, or some offshore forex brokers offer leverage as high as 1:1000 or more, which may appeal to more experienced or professional traders seeking greater trading flexibility and higher potential returns.

What is Leverage in Forex Trading?
Leverage in trading refers to the use of borrowed capital to increase potential returns on an investment. It allows traders to control larger positions with a relatively small amount of their own funds, known as margin. For example, with a leverage ratio of 100:1, a trader can control $10,000 worth of assets with just $100. This amplifies both potential profits and potential losses, making it a powerful but risky tool.
In forex and CFD trading, leverage varies depending on the broker and regulatory conditions. For major currency pairs, leverage can range from 10:1 to 500:1 or higher with offshore brokers. While leverage increases trading opportunities, it also magnifies risks, especially in volatile markets. Traders should employ proper risk management, such as setting stop-loss orders and maintaining sufficient margin levels when using high leverage. A trader should understand the impact of high leverage carefully as it can enhance gains but also lead to substantial losses if the market moves unfavorably
Do Forex Brokers Offer High Leverage in Ireland?
Yes, forex brokers in Ireland can offer high leverage through professional accounts or via their offshore entities. In line with European regulations, brokers typically provide a fixed leverage of 1:30 for major currency pairs, as set by regulatory authorities like ESMA. However, professional traders may access higher leverage through specific professional accounts, which are subject to different regulatory standards. Additionally, some forex brokers operating through offshore entities may offer higher leverage to attract international clients.
Brokers that offer high leverage in Ireland often do so through professional accounts, where the leverage can go up to 1:500 or even higher. This provides traders with the ability to control larger positions with smaller capital requirements. For traders outside of Ireland or those using offshore entities, brokers may offer leverage as high as 1:1000 or 1:3000, depending on the regulatory environment in the jurisdiction where the entity is based.
